WBO Africa Bantamweight Champion Theophilus Kpakpo Allotey is leading the Boxing Ghana Pound for Pound ratings for the month of September 2025.
He has overtaken Holy Dorgbetor who reigned for two months.
Daniel Gorsh who led at the beginning of the year has dropped to fourth position as others are climbing.
WBO Africa Lightweight Champion Faisal Abubakar aka Poncho Power has moved up to the third position, Shakul Samed who fought at the WBC Grand Prix is at the fifth position, Joseph Commey, the National and UBO Lightweight Champion is at number 6. while another power puncher Emmanuel Mankatah who holds the UBO Africa Super Featherweight title has joined the top ranks.
The Boxing Ghana monthly rankings is based on fight frequently, performance, media appearances, activeness and quality of fight platforms or organisations staging bouts such as WBC, IBF, WBA, WBO, ABU or ABU.
Recently a number of Ghanaian boxers have been rated by the African Boxing Union ABU where Theo Allotey is number 5.
He is number 5 at IBF, 15 in the WBO recent ratiings 8 at IBO Intercontinental and 9 at IBC respectively.
Theo Allotey who is preparing for a WBC International shot told Yours Truly on The Big Fight Night at Omashi TV, he is very happy with his new status as number one in Ghana and his journey to reach the top and claim the ultimate world title has just began.
He said the new ratings has motivated and inspired him to push harder.
His trainer Coach Dr. Ofori Asare also said Theo is coming like a rocket and should be supported to realise his dream after representing Ghana and excelling at the amateur level.
He expressed that within eleven months they have really worked very hard and leaving no stone unturned till they achieve the goal if winning a world title.
He appealed to the government and companies to support Team Allotey.
Allotey was the shining star at the Paris 2024 Olympic Qualifiers and won a medal for Ghana at the African Games before turning professional.
He currently holds the National and UBA Africa Super Flyweight title and showed his talent, skill and power against Daniel Gorsh for the WBO Africa Bantamweight Championship.
